Arlington vs Loudoun County: Which is right for your family?

Arlington offers urban energy with a neighborhood feel. Loudoun County is one of the fastest-growing counties in Virginia, spanning the Dulles Airport tech corridor, the Silver Line Metro extension (Ashburn, Loudoun Gateway), and western wine country (Leesburg, Purcellville, Middleburg). Both are strong options, but the details matter. Here is how they compare across price, schools, commute, taxes, walkability, and safety.

Market Overview

Arlington is pricier ($750K median vs $620K), a difference of about $130K. Arlington moves faster, with homes averaging 10 days on market compared to 16 in Loudoun County. Loudoun County offers a lower entry point at $300K–$10M+.

Is Arlington or Loudoun County more affordable?

Loudoun County is more affordable with a median home price of $620K, compared to $750K in Arlington. Both cities offer a wide range of housing options, from condos and townhomes to single-family homes. Arlington prices range from $350K–$2.5M. Loudoun County prices range from $300K–$10M+.
